While there are lots of financial services jobs you can choose today, some are more sought-after than others. For example, roles in financial investment banking are some of the most popular in corporate finance, and this is largely thanks here to the excellent pay bundles and the professional development chances. In basic terms, financial investment banking organises large monetary transactions such as initial public offerings (IPO) and mergers and acquisitions (M&A). Their customers might be big corporations, organisations, pension funds, and hedge funds. Financial investment banks likewise offer other crucial options such as reorganisations, assistance with the sale of securities, and trade brokering. This makes working in this domain extremely satisfying and interesting given that experts can anticipate to get involved in various financial deals, not to mention getting a much deeper understanding of the functions of international financial markets. When pondering financial services careers, many people seem to instantly assume that they need to be proficient at mathematics and have great numeracy abilities. While these qualities are certainly essential in finance, not all roles require them. Today, the finance industry is powered by sophisticated technologies and digitisation efforts have actually been in progress since the early 2000s. This means that there is huge demand for tech specialists who can add value to the businesses they work for. Whether it's a hedge fund, retail bank, or private equity company, any financial institution will require skilled developers and service technicians to work on some innovative services. Beyond this, there are other specific niches in finance that focus more on sales and product development, with the insurance industry being a prime example. In most cases, working in insurance coverage doesn't require advanced numeracy abilities, with the Switzerland financial services sector housing many insurers that are always after top talent.
The financial services industry provides a variety of financial services to corporates and private clients, with many niches specialising in specific domains. In this context, among the most popular financial services companies are firms that specialise in asset management. These firms offer strategic investment suggestions to private and institutional financiers to help them develop resistant and profitable portfolios. Given that each customer will have a different budget plan and particular financial goals, investment managers create custom financial investment methods to help customers reach their goals with very little effort. Asset management companies do all the heavy lifting and they use advanced technologies and leverage data insights to extract the most ROI possible all while mitigating risks. All the customer needs to do is communicate their goals and leave it to the professionals.
